Indications of Oral Emergency Situations



Identifying the indicators of dental emergencies is crucial for punctual action and appropriate treatment. If you experience extreme tooth pain that's constant and throbbing, it could show a hidden problem that needs instant interest.

Swelling in the periodontals, face, or jaw can additionally be a sign of an oral emergency situation, specifically if it's accompanied by pain or fever. Any type of kind of trauma to the mouth resulting in a cracked, damaged, or knocked-out tooth ought to be dealt with as an emergency situation to avoid further damage and prospective infection.

Bleeding from the mouth that does not quit after applying stress for a couple of mins is another red flag that you should look for emergency oral treatment. Furthermore, if you see any kind of signs of infection such as pus, a nasty taste in your mouth, or a fever, it's important to see a dentist immediately.

Disregarding these signs can cause extra severe issues, so it's important to act quickly when faced with a prospective dental emergency situation.
